The Allen-Bradley 5094-IB16 is an input module utilized in Allen-Bradley automation systems, crafted specifically for distributed I/O solutions. This module is part of the 5094 Series and serves as a dependable interface for integrating various industrial devices into automation systems. Below are the key specifications and features of the 5094-IB16 module:
Technical Specifications:
- Model: 5094-IB16
- Series: 5094 I/O Modules
- Type: Digital Input Module
- Input Type: 16 Digital Inputs
- Input Voltage: 24V DC
- Current Rating: Each input draws 8 mA maximum
- Input Logic: Sinking or Sourcing
- Mounting: Panel or Rack Mountable
- Connection: Spring Clamp or Screw Terminal for wiring
- Response Time: Fast response time for real-time control in critical systems
- Operating Temperature: 0°C to 60°C (32°F to 140°F)
- Storage Temperature: -40°C to 85°C (-40°F to 185°F)
- Dimensions: 4.5 x 3.3 x 3.1 inches (114 x 84 x 78 mm)
- Weight: 0.5 kg (1.1 lbs)
- Certifications: UL, CE, and RoHS compliant
- Power Consumption: Typically 24V DC powered
- Status Indicators: LED indicators for each input to show the status of signals
Key Features:
- 16 Digital Inputs: Provides 16 digital inputs that can be configured to handle a variety of industrial signals, making it a versatile option for many automation systems.
- 24V DC Input Voltage: The module is designed to operate with 24V DC input signals, which is common in industrial automation environments.
- Sinking or Sourcing Input Logic: Compatible with both sinking and sourcing input devices, ensuring compatibility with a wide range of field devices such as sensors, switches, and pushbuttons.
- Compact and Efficient: The 5094-IB16 offers a compact design that can be easily integrated into existing systems, with real-time performance and fast response times for critical applications.
- Status LEDs: Each input channel is equipped with LED indicators that provide a clear visual indication of input status, improving troubleshooting and diagnostics.
- Durability: Built for industrial environments, the module can operate in harsh conditions with a wide operating temperature range.
- Easy Integration: The Spring Clamp or Screw Terminal connection system allows for quick and easy wiring, making installation and setup easier.
- Efficient Power Consumption: Designed to consume minimal power while providing reliable and consistent input signal processing.
Applications:
- Automated Manufacturing Systems: Used in automated production lines to monitor and control inputs such as sensors and actuators.
- Conveyor Systems: Ideal for detecting the position of items along conveyor belts or in material handling systems.
- Control Systems: Used for integrating input signals from field devices into centralized control systems.
- Robotics: Can be used to collect signals from sensors in robotic systems for precise control of motion.
- Process Control: Suitable for monitoring and controlling processes in industrial environments like water treatment plants, food processing, and packaging
